In today’s data-driven digital landscape, the ability to efficiently extract and process information from websites has become a cornerstone of successful business operations. Scraper APIs have emerged as powerful tools that enable organizations to automate data collection processes, transforming how we approach web scraping and information gathering.
Understanding Scraper APIs: The Foundation of Modern Data Extraction
A scraper API represents a sophisticated interface that allows developers and businesses to programmatically extract data from websites without the complexities traditionally associated with web scraping. Unlike conventional scraping methods that require extensive coding knowledge and constant maintenance, these APIs provide streamlined solutions that handle the technical intricacies behind the scenes.
The evolution of scraper APIs has been remarkable. From simple HTML parsers to intelligent systems capable of handling JavaScript-heavy websites, modern scraping solutions have transformed into comprehensive platforms that can navigate complex web architectures, manage cookies, handle sessions, and even bypass anti-bot measures.
The Technical Architecture Behind Scraper APIs
Modern scraper APIs operate on sophisticated infrastructures designed to handle large-scale data extraction operations. These systems typically incorporate several key components:
- Proxy Management Systems: Rotating IP addresses to avoid detection and blocking
- Browser Emulation: Mimicking real user behavior through headless browsers
- Rate Limiting Controls: Ensuring respectful scraping practices
- Data Processing Pipelines: Converting raw HTML into structured, usable formats
- Error Handling Mechanisms: Managing failures and retry logic automatically
The integration of machine learning algorithms has further enhanced these systems, enabling them to adapt to website changes and improve extraction accuracy over time. This intelligent approach significantly reduces the manual intervention traditionally required in web scraping projects.
Business Applications and Use Cases
The versatility of scraper APIs has led to their adoption across numerous industries and applications. E-commerce businesses leverage these tools for competitive price monitoring, enabling them to adjust pricing strategies in real-time based on market conditions. A recent study indicated that companies using automated price monitoring through scraper APIs experienced an average revenue increase of 15-20%.
In the realm of market research, organizations utilize scraper APIs to gather consumer sentiment data from social media platforms, review sites, and forums. This information provides invaluable insights into customer preferences and market trends, allowing businesses to make data-driven decisions with confidence.
The real estate sector has particularly benefited from scraper API implementation. Property listing aggregators use these tools to compile comprehensive databases from multiple sources, providing consumers with centralized platforms for property searches. Similarly, investment firms employ scraping technologies to monitor property values and market fluctuations across different geographical regions.
Advantages of Implementing Scraper APIs
The adoption of scraper APIs offers numerous advantages over traditional data collection methods. Scalability stands as one of the most significant benefits, as these systems can handle thousands of requests simultaneously, processing vast amounts of data within compressed timeframes.
From a cost-effectiveness perspective, scraper APIs eliminate the need for extensive development teams dedicated to building and maintaining custom scraping solutions. This reduction in overhead allows organizations to allocate resources more efficiently while achieving superior results.
The reliability factor cannot be understated. Professional scraper API services maintain high uptime percentages, often exceeding 99.9%, ensuring consistent data flow for business-critical operations. This reliability is particularly crucial for applications requiring real-time data updates, such as financial trading platforms or news aggregation services.
Navigating Legal and Ethical Considerations
The implementation of scraper APIs must be approached with careful consideration of legal and ethical implications. Compliance with terms of service remains paramount, as websites increasingly implement sophisticated measures to detect and prevent unauthorized data extraction.
The concept of respectful scraping has gained prominence within the industry. This approach emphasizes the importance of implementing reasonable delays between requests, respecting robots.txt files, and avoiding excessive server load that could impact website performance for legitimate users.
Data privacy regulations, including GDPR and CCPA, have introduced additional layers of complexity to scraping operations. Organizations must ensure that their data collection practices align with applicable privacy laws, particularly when dealing with personally identifiable information.
Technical Implementation Strategies
Successful scraper API implementation requires careful planning and strategic approach. API selection should be based on specific project requirements, including target websites, data volume expectations, and budget constraints. Leading providers offer different pricing models, from pay-per-request to subscription-based plans.
The integration process typically involves several phases. Initial endpoint configuration establishes the connection between your application and the scraper API service. This phase includes authentication setup, request formatting, and response handling mechanisms.
Data validation and cleaning represent critical components of the implementation process. Raw scraped data often requires processing to remove inconsistencies, handle missing values, and standardize formats. Many modern scraper APIs include built-in data processing capabilities, reducing the manual effort required for data preparation.
For developers seeking comprehensive solutions, platforms like api downloader provide integrated environments that simplify the entire scraping workflow, from initial setup to data delivery.
Performance Optimization and Best Practices
Optimizing scraper API performance involves multiple considerations. Request optimization includes batching operations where possible, implementing intelligent retry mechanisms, and utilizing caching strategies to reduce redundant requests.
Monitoring and analytics play crucial roles in maintaining optimal performance. Implementing comprehensive logging systems enables teams to identify bottlenecks, track success rates, and optimize scraping strategies based on real-world performance data.
The importance of error handling cannot be overstated. Robust scraping implementations include sophisticated error detection and recovery mechanisms that can adapt to various failure scenarios, from temporary network issues to website structure changes.
Emerging Trends and Future Outlook
The future of scraper APIs appears increasingly sophisticated, with several emerging trends shaping the industry landscape. Artificial intelligence integration is enabling more intelligent data extraction capabilities, allowing systems to understand context and extract relevant information even from unstructured content.
Real-time processing capabilities are becoming standard features, enabling applications that require immediate data updates. This trend is particularly relevant for financial services, news aggregation, and social media monitoring applications.
The development of specialized APIs for specific industries continues to accelerate. These targeted solutions offer pre-configured extraction templates optimized for particular use cases, reducing implementation complexity and improving accuracy.
Security and Infrastructure Considerations
Modern scraper API implementations must address increasingly sophisticated security challenges. Anti-bot detection systems have become more advanced, requiring scraping solutions to employ multiple evasion techniques, including browser fingerprinting randomization and behavioral pattern mimicking.
Infrastructure resilience has become a key differentiator among scraper API providers. Leading services maintain distributed infrastructures across multiple geographical regions, ensuring consistent performance and availability even during regional outages or restrictions.
The implementation of advanced proxy networks enables scraping operations to maintain anonymity while accessing geo-restricted content. These networks often include residential IP addresses that appear more legitimate to target websites.
Measuring Success and ROI
Evaluating the success of scraper API implementations requires comprehensive metrics beyond simple data volume measurements. Data quality assessments should examine accuracy rates, completeness percentages, and freshness indicators to ensure that extracted information meets business requirements.
Cost-benefit analysis should consider both direct costs associated with API usage and indirect benefits such as time savings, improved decision-making capabilities, and competitive advantages gained through superior data access.
The operational efficiency gained through automation often represents the most significant return on investment. Organizations frequently report productivity improvements of 300-500% when transitioning from manual data collection methods to automated scraper API solutions.
Conclusion: Embracing the Future of Data Extraction
Scraper APIs have fundamentally transformed the landscape of data extraction, offering unprecedented capabilities for businesses seeking to harness the power of web-based information. As these technologies continue to evolve, organizations that embrace scraper API solutions position themselves advantageously in an increasingly data-driven marketplace.
The key to successful implementation lies in understanding both the technical capabilities and practical limitations of these tools. By approaching scraper API adoption with careful planning, ethical considerations, and strategic implementation, businesses can unlock significant value from the vast repositories of information available across the internet.
As we look toward the future, the continued advancement of scraper API technology promises even greater capabilities, making sophisticated data extraction accessible to organizations of all sizes. The question is no longer whether to implement scraper APIs, but rather how to do so most effectively to achieve specific business objectives.
Leave a Reply